Wright Brand has been my bacon of choice for many years. But due to recommendations by the board, i bought a pack of Conecuh bacon yesterday. We'll see how it stacks up.

I tried to make my own bacon one time, and i failed pretty miserably. I bought a 3 lb. pork belly and the recipe i used called for 6 lbs. I didn't think it would matter. But the bacon was the saltiest thing i ever ate. I thought i could at least use it for salt mean when cooking greens. Nope. It made your tongue hurt it was so salty.

I followed a recipe in a book i have on charcuterie. I'll try again in the future.

Until recently, the thick sliced bacon I'd get from Costco under the Kirkland brand. Meaty, good smoke flavor and fries up nice.

I finally got done with my cold smoker and made homemade bacon out of pork belly----also from Costco----and it came out OK for now, but I see I'll have to tweak my brining recipe a bit to get the flavor I want.
